ORDER

This Criminal Original Petition has been filed to transfer the investigation of the case in Crime No.91 of 2019 from the file of the third respondent to any other investigating agency.

2. When the matter is taken up for hearing today, the learned Government Advocate (criminal side) submitted that the second respondent completed the investigation in Crime No.91 of 2019 and filed charge-sheet on the file of the learned Judicial Magistrate, Eraniel and the same has also been taken cognizance in C.C.No.370 of 2020 and it is pending for trial. https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/ 1/2

Crl.O.P.(MD)No.6397 of 2020

3. In view of the above, the prayer sought for in this petition has become infructuous. Accordingly, this Criminal Original Petition is dismissed as infructuous.
